Prosecutors in Orange County Friday announced they added hate crime charges in a mass shooting at a Presbyterian church in Laguna Woods, reports ABC7 News. Authorities accuse David Wenwei Chou of killing one man and injuring five others at Irvine Taiwanese Presbyterian Church because of his political hatred for Taiwan. Police say the Las Vegas man attended a service that day and later attended a luncheon to honor a former pastor. CNN also reports authorities said Chou had a bag of molotov cocktails and extra ammunition. Dr. John Cheng died when the gunman shot him as he charged to try to subdue the suspect.
